Key duties and role expectations
As the appointee you will work independently and manage the delivery of business analysis and requirements, process re-design and improvements to enable the successful delivery and maintenance of Information and Technology services. You are also responsible for establishing the testing strategies and plans for all solutions and services to ensure robust and consistent delivery for our client.
- Develop gap analysis, requirements elicitation (functional and non-functional), analysis and prioritisation, specification, management, and traceability.
- Map business requirements and processes to the functionality of a product whilst identifying gaps and opportunities.
- Manage the translation of business needs and requirements into technical and solutions requirements.
- Develop, refine, and apply analytical tools, methods, and techniques to support resource analysis; lifecycle cost estimation; cost-effectiveness analysis of alternatives; acquisition planning; program risk assessment; investment strategy/portfolio optimization; business process/model development.
- Manage the development of testing strategies and user acceptance testing plans for solutions delivery projects Embed a culture of service excellence, innovation and continuous improvement founded on cohesiveness, teamwork, and flexibility.
